Exposure Assessment To Respirable Crystalline Silica Particles During Airfield Maintnenance Concrete Operations, Kenneth Pratt
Exposure Assessment To Respirable Crystalline Silica Particles During Airfield Maintnenance Concrete Operations, Kenneth Pratt
Graduate Theses & Non-Theses
Crystalline silica is found in naturally occurring and manmade materials. According to OSHA, approximately 2.2 million people are exposed to silica each year (OSHA, 2002). These individuals are at an increased risk of silicosis, an incurable disease that is often fatal. The objective of this project was to determine if airport maintenance workers are exposed to crystalline silica over the current permissible exposure limit. Two days of sampling was conducted and it was determined that there was some exposure to the Airfield Paint Crew exceeding the action level. Occupational Silica Exposure For The Fuel Distributing Company On Hydraulic Fracturing Locations, Caleb Moore
Occupational Silica Exposure For The Fuel Distributing Company On Hydraulic Fracturing Locations, Caleb Moore
Graduate Theses & Non-Theses
This report investigates the potential exposure to respirable crystalline silica experienced by fuel distributing employees on hydraulic fracturing locations. Hydraulic fracturing is an oil and gas technique used to develop shale formations all across the United States of America. This is done by injecting large volumes of water, sand, and treatment chemicals under high pressure into oil wells within the shale formation. This well stimulation is possible due to the high pressure of the fluid, which creates and opens cracks and fissures in the formation. A Pilot Study To Assess The Impact Of The Proposed Crystalline Silica Standard In The Construction Industry, Kendra Lyons
A Pilot Study To Assess The Impact Of The Proposed Crystalline Silica Standard In The Construction Industry, Kendra Lyons
Graduate Theses & Non-Theses
No worker should have to suffer a life altering or fatal illness for the sake of a job, yet thousands of workers have died or developed a disabling illness from occupational exposure to silica. The Occupational Safety and Health Administration (OSHA) has not updated the permissible exposure limit (PEL) for silica since 1971. The current PEL for respirable crystalline silica in the construction industry is 250 mppcf/ (%SiO2 + 5) TWA which is adjusted per the amount of silica in the sample. Health And Safety Considerations Associated With Sodium Debris Bed Experimental Nuclear Assembly Dismantlement, Alan Carvo
Graduate Theses & Non-Theses
As the end of World War II approached, scientists who developed the processes to generate nuclear material for war-time use grew interested in applying those technologies to the generation of power for cities across the United States. Concerns about the availability of natural uranium led to the development of self-fueling fast neutron breeder reactors. In order to produce plutonium at a rate greater than the consumption of uranium during a nuclear chain reaction, high-energy “fast” neutrons are required. Fast neutron reactors utilize low melting-point metals, like sodium, to provide cooling.

Beryllium In Electrical Switchgear, Eric Hokanson
Beryllium In Electrical Switchgear, Eric Hokanson
Graduate Theses & Non-Theses
Beryllium is a naturally occurring element with many unique properties and a variety of uses. When combined with other elements, such as copper, specialized alloys may be made that are of particular value for certain applications. In the electrical industry copper beryllium alloys are frequently present in electrical components in the contactors, relays, springs and other metallic components. Though beryllium has many excellent physical properties and poses minimal to no human health hazard when in a solid finished form, inhaling the dust or fumes of beryllium containing materials can cause serious health issues. Comparison Of Wet Wipe Vs Micro-Vacuum Sampling Techniques For Determining Concentrations Of Asbestos In Surface Dust, Natalie Shaw
Comparison Of Wet Wipe Vs Micro-Vacuum Sampling Techniques For Determining Concentrations Of Asbestos In Surface Dust, Natalie Shaw
Graduate Theses & Non-Theses
The objective of the study was to evaluate the detection efficiency of micro-vacuum surface sampling and surface wet wipe sampling in homes that had been identified with vermiculite attic insulation and/or other asbestos containing materials. Surface samples were collected pre and post weatherization activities and analyzed by transmission electron microscopy. Baseline sampling revealed that wet wipe sampling was more likely to detect surface asbestos contamination than micro-vacuum sampling; 55% of surface wet wipe samples revealed detectable asbestos compared to 17% of micro-vacuum samples. An Evaluation Of Carbon Concentrations Associated With Biodiesel Particulate Matter In An Underground Metal Mine, David Evans
An Evaluation Of Carbon Concentrations Associated With Biodiesel Particulate Matter In An Underground Metal Mine, David Evans
Graduate Theses & Non-Theses
Exposure to diesel particulate matter from diesel exhaust has been shown to have adverse health effects in humans. In 2012 The International Agency for Research on Cancer classified diesel exhaust as a group 1 know human carcinogen. Because of the associated health effects, there has been a strong push to reduce the amount of diesel exhaust present in the mining industry. Biodiesel is one to the more common and promising control options used to reduce the amount of diesel particulate matter that is generated during fuel combustion.
